Almond Butter Chocolate Banana (Printable version)

Banana slices layered with almond butter, coated in rich chocolate for an irresistible bite-sized snack.

# What you need:

→ Core Ingredients

01 - 2 medium ripe bananas
02 - 1/3 cup almond butter
03 - 3.5 ounces dark chocolate (60-70% cocoa), chopped
04 - 1 tablespoon coconut oil

→ Toppings (optional)

05 - 1 tablespoon chopped toasted almonds
06 - Pinch of sea salt flakes

# How to Make It:

01 - Peel bananas and cut them into uniform 1/2-inch rounds.
02 - Spread approximately 1/2 teaspoon almond butter onto half the banana slices, then sandwich with the remaining slices.
03 - Arrange banana sandwiches on a parchment-lined baking sheet and freeze for 45 minutes until firm.
04 - Place chopped dark chocolate and coconut oil in a microwave-safe bowl; heat in 20-second intervals, stirring between each, until fully melted and smooth.
05 - Using a fork, dip each frozen banana bite into the melted chocolate to coat. Sprinkle with chopped almonds and a pinch of sea salt while chocolate is still wet.
06 - Return bites to the lined tray and freeze another 20 minutes, or until chocolate sets. Serve frozen or slightly thawed.

03 -
  • Use parchment or silicone mats to prevent sticking
  • Work quickly with cold bananas so the chocolate sets fast
  • Sprinkle salt or crushed nuts right after dipping before chocolate firms up
